The Mechanics of Balance Changes
Casino games operate on a simple principle: each game has a specific house edge, meaning the odds inherently favor the casino. This house edge is crucial in understanding how player balances can fluctuate dramatically. Players deposit funds into their accounts, and as they play games, their balance shifts based on wins, losses, and bonuses.
For instance, a player might enter a gaming session with a $100 balance. As they engage with a slot machine, their balance may rise or fall depending on their outcomes. Winning big can temporarily inflate their balance, but it is essential to remain aware that losses are also a possibility that will invariably affect this figure.

The Psychological Impact of Balance Fluctuations
As players engage in casino gaming, they often experience emotional highs and lows tied to their balance changes. Winning can lead to feelings of euphoria and increased confidence, while losses might result in frustration or regret. Understanding this psychological aspect is essential for responsible gaming practices.
Players should be mindful of their emotional responses to balance changes. Keeping a clear perspective can help in managing expectations and promoting a healthier gaming experience. Setting limits and understanding when to walk away are crucial components of maintaining an enjoyable relationship with gambling.
